    There are 2 Jet Li movies, one called Fearless which is about Hua Yuanjia and another called Fist of Legend which is about Chen Zhen. Bruce Lee also made a Chen Zhen movie called The Chinese Connection.

    There are also few TV adaptations.

    Hua Yuanjia series:

    - The Legendary Fok made by ATV in 1981
    - Hua Yuan Jia (starring Ekin Cheng and Jordan Chan) made by China in 2007

    Chen Zhen series:

    - The Fist (starring Bruce Liang) made by ATV in 1982
    - Fist of Fury (starring Donnie Yen) made by ATV in 1995
    - Chen Zhen 2008 (starring Jordan Chan) made by China in 2008

    It seems not too many realize that there's another 2 part series made in 2001. That one stars Vincent Zhao as Huo and Wu Yue (of Secret of Linked Cities) as Chen. This was Wu's debut.

    I watched the Chen Zhen series before the Huo series starring Zhao Wen Zhuo. Hmmm, have to say the Chen series was better. The Huo series dragged on and on with repetitious scenes and bad editing and was basically killing time to stretch what could have been a 15 episode series into a 30 episode one.

    Also, they used the same actress for the female lead and the same child actor to play the same child characters. (the kid who played young YG in ROCH2006) Weird.
